El Camino De Cristo Group's story
This communal bank of 7 members is located in Matagalpa, Nicaragua, and is very organised. The members are active in the following businesses: food sales, grocery store, animal husbandry.
Gladys (in the white shirt and blue skirt), 37, has two sons and two daughters who all attend school. Her husband works in the fields. She is the borrower this time around and her business is a grocery store she has had for four years. What she loves about it is that she can earn money from home and keep an eye on her children. Her main challenge are periods of low sales. She will use the loan to buy 45 kg of sugar, 45 kg of rice, sweets, 20 pounds of chicken, and a crate of fizzy drinks. This way, she will grow her business. Her goals for the future are to keep this growth going by restocking. She advises all women in her situation to take advantage of the loans offered by the field partner to start a business.
This loan supports an entrepreneur who is determined to keep growing her business.
